The C-1 Cercanías train to Málaga Centro-Alameda costs €1.80 and takes 12 minutes. Platforms in Terminal 3 are accessible via the connecting corridor. Run every 20–30 minutes.Taxis to Málaga center: €15–20. To Marbella: €60–80 (45–60 min). To Torremolinos or Benalmádena: €15–25. Rental car desks are in the arrivals hall; the N-340 coastal road provides good access to resort towns.
Mediterranean climate. One of the sunniest airports in Europe. Summers (June–September) are hot and dry at 28–36°C; virtually no rain and minimal disruption risk. Winters are mild at 10–18°C with occasional rain, rarely causing serious delays.
The Levante (easterly wind) can cause turbulence on approach, particularly in autumn. November through January sees the most rainfall. The airport handles heavy seasonal traffic peaks in July and August. Arrive early for check-in during summer.

Flights from BTS to AGP
M. R. Štefánik Airport (BTS) and Málaga-Costa del Sol Airport (AGP) are connected by nonstop service from Ryanair and Wizz Air. With 8 weekly departures, this is a regularly served route.
BTS to AGP Flight Duration and Schedule
Nonstop flight time from BTS to AGP is about 3 hours 30 minutes gate to gate. The route covers a distance of 1,355 miles (2,181 km). There are approximately 8 weekly flights outbound and 8 return, totaling 16 flights per week in both directions.
Connecting Options and Alternatives
1-stop connecting options are also available, commonly via Josep Tarradellas Barcelona-El Prat, Palma de Mallorca and Warsaw Chopin. Two-stop connections are also available via intermediate hubs. Nearby alternative airports include Vienna (VIE), Brno (BRQ) and Budapest (BUD).
